There are all-natural pearls, yet they are so rare that you need to firmly insist on a certificate ensuring their credibility (much more on such certifications listed below) and just purchase from a well-known business that focuses on all-natural pearls. One of the most recognized jewelry stores and auction houses in the world have been deceived into marketing cultured pearls as natural and right into selling dealt with tinted rocks as without treatment.

The only way to assure that the rock you are buying has not been dealt with in this method is to be sure that you can return the stone after having it evaluated by an independent specialist. A close friend of mine is among the leading ruby experts in the United States, and he just recently paid $300,000 for a large ruby that ended up being injected with tinted glass.

This will certainly additionally give you wonderful leverage in rate. Tiny stones (under half a carat) are usually embeded in a piece of fashion jewelry, which's to be expected. You ought to ask for the piece to be cleaned prior to you examine it, analyze it very carefully with your nude eye, and then ask for a loupea kind of magnifying glasswith which to appraise it more carefully.

And if the item is inexpensivesay, $1,000 or lessloupe it only extremely casually, if whatsoever - Wholesale Jeweler. The extra expensive a piece is, the even more time you ought to invest examining it. If a stone is huge, you need to ask to have it drew so you can check it loose. Defects are hidden under prongs.

A typical technique is to set a brownish ruby in yellow gold prongs to make it appear extra like a canary. A bezel-set stonea stone covered entirely in metalis likely being misrepresented in terms of its shade, weight, or proportions. Jewelers make use of metal to conceal or enhance the top quality of what they are offering.


Usage that as component of your bargaining leverage. Once more, explain that you will have the rock drew as component of the evaluation procedure. If it's an antique or developer item, he may object that removing it would spoil the integrity of the ring. Rubbish. Any kind of expert jewelry expert can re-inlay a rock that has actually been embeded in a bezel.
